The first series contains a series of regional views of Florida, by the Art Photogravure Company of Racine, Wisconsin, 1904. A photogravure is created with the use of an intaglio copper plate, made from the original photograph , and printed like an engraving. This slow, hand-made process often produced a limited number of plates, as the plates are shallower and weaker than ordinary engravers' plates. The inks used in the printing process produce a "soft" appearance, that may be altered to achieve the artistic effect desired by the printer.
